串口打开问题(急)
我写了一段串口程序:中间打开串口片段如下
hCom=CreateFile(L"COM3",//COM3口
GENERIC_READ|GENERIC_WRITE, //允许读和写
FILE_SHARE_READ|FILE_SHARE_WRITE, //非独占方式
NULL,
OPEN_EXISTING, //打开而不是创建
NULL, //同步方式
NULL);
if(hCom==(HANDLE)-1)
{
AfxMessageBox(L"打开COM失败!");
return FALSE;
}
这个可以打开我自己电脑的COM3口 运行正常 但是我换一台电脑 把COM3变成COM13口 那台电脑上面其他COM口还连接有其他设备 运行一下就显示的是“打开COM失败!” 应该是什么原因?
[解决办法]
COM3
忘了冒号了吧
[解决办法]